City of Naperville Transportation Advisory Board met Aug. 7.

Here is the agenda provided by the board:

A. CALL TO ORDER:

B. ROLL CALL:

C. PUBLIC FORUM:

D. REPORTS AND RECOMMENDATIONS:

1 25-0840 Approve the Minutes of the June 5, 2025, Transportation Advisory Board Meeting

2 25-1013 Receive the Police Department report

3 25-1009Receive the presentation and provide input on the proposed update to the City’s Road Improvement Plan

4 25-0960 Approve a recommendation to establish overnight parking exemptions for Carrolwood neighborhood

5 25-1027 Approve a recommendation to establish a no parking restriction for mailboxes

6 25-1022 Approve a recommendation to establish a 25 MPH speed limit for the Naper Commons subdivision (Item 1 of 3)

8 25-1025 Approve a recommendation to establish right-of-way controls for the Naper Commons subdivision (Item 2 of 3)

7 25-1026 Approve a recommendation to establish one-way streets for Naper Commons subdivision (Item 3 of 3)

9 25-1012 Receive board and commission member training
